platformio专题

platformio烧写STC8H1K08单片机程序失败:Serial port error: read timeout

问题 在使用platformio进行STC8H1K08单片机开发,在烧录编译好的程序时失败了,烧录过程日志如下: * 正在执行任务: C:\Users\23043036\.platformio\penv\Scripts\platformio.exe run --target upload Processing STC8H1K08 (platform: intel_mcs51; board:

使用 ESP32 和 PlatformIO (arduino框架)实现 Over-the-Air(OTA)固件更新

使用 ESP32 和 PlatformIO 实现 Over-the-Air(OTA)固件更新 摘要: 本文将介绍如何在 ESP32 上使用 PlatformIO 环境实现 OTA(Over-the-Air)固件更新。OTA 更新使得在设备部署在远程位置时,无需物理接触设备,就可以通过网络更新固件,大大提高了设备维护和管理的便捷性。 介绍: 随着物联网技术的发展,越来越多的设备需要进行固件更

【ESP32之旅】合宙ESP32-C3 使用PlatformIO编译和Debug调试

工程创建 首先打开PIO Home窗口,然后点击New Project来创建新的工程,工程配置选择如下图所示: 注: 选择板子型号的时候需要选择ESP32C3,勾选取消Location可以自定义路径。 修改配置文件 工程创建完毕之后在工程根目录中会生成一个platformio.ini的配置文件,此配置文件描述了工程中的一些编译配置项和平台参数类似于Arduino中的编译选项,目录结构如

CLion上用platformIO开发esp32,CLion开发esp32详细配置流程

太爱Jetbrains了!!!     上次用烦了keil写stm32,Clion马上给俺整了个2019.1更新,直接整合了stm32CubeMX,从此抛弃keil.     最近毕设选择了用esp32,然后用platformIO来做为开发平台.(不得不说,platformIO真不愧是新时代嵌入式开发神器啊,感觉嵌入式开发的体验一下子进入了21世纪.真心劝没有了解过的小伙伴们了解一下.)

Vscode + PlatformIO + Arduino 搭建EPS32开发环境

Vscode + PlatformIO + Arduino 搭建EPS32开发环境 文章目录 Vscode + PlatformIO + Arduino 搭建EPS32开发环境1. Vscode插件安装2. 使用PlatformIO新建工程3.工程文件的基本结构4.一个基本的测试用例Reference 1. Vscode插件安装 如何下载vscode这里不再赘述,完成基本的安

基于VSCode + PlatformIO创建运行第一个esp32程序

文章目录 使用VSCode创建项目安装驱动下载驱动安装驱动连接开发板电脑识别开发板 编写程序烧录程序第一步、编译程序第二步、烧录程序第三步、开发板观察效果 原理讲解项目源码 在之前的课程,我们已经介绍了ESP32单片机,并且也已经安装好了开发环境,从这节课开始,我们将正式步入ESP32的实战开发中来。 说到单片机开发,开篇一定离不开点亮LED灯,我们也不例外,接下来,我们一起写

platformio 提示 fatal error: TimeLib.h: No such file or directory 的解决方案

在platformio编译arduino项目的时候,如果提示fatal error: TimeLib.h: No such file or directory,解决方法有2: 方法1: 在项目的platformio.ini文件中,添加 lib_deps =# Using library Id44 方法2: 通过library添加到项目中 然后platformio.ini会自动修改:

VScode+PlatformIO 物联网Iot开发平台环境搭建

1.vscode (1)安装platformIO插件 (2)新建项目或导入已有的arduino项目 Name:需要填写你项目的名称; Board:点开是一个下拉框,但是可以输入你想要的开发板,这里选择"Espressif ESP32 Dev Module" framework:自动选择Arduino; Location:这里注意必须点击取消这个蓝色的对号,选择刚刚你创建的那

【机器人】Platformio STM32 arduino配置和测试

1.实验环境 我用的板子是Nucleo F302R8,板载STLINKV2,为了测试一下Platformio的arduino框架下编写STM32程序,进行了实验,踩了点坑,特此记录。 2.踩坑 前期配置非常简单,网上教程很多,就是New一个Project,然后框架选择Arduino即可,等待下载好就可以了。然后改写platformio.ini文件为 [env:nucleo_f302r8]

快速入门ESP32—— 解决platformIO添加开源库下载失败的问题

相关文章 快速入门ESP32——开发环境配置Arduino IDE 快速入门ESP32——开发环境配置PlatformIO IDE 快速入门ESP32—— platformIO添加开源库和自己的开发库 快速入门ESP32—— 解决platformIO添加开源库下载失败的问题 前言一、通过github链接直接下载1、下载步骤2、现象 前言  由于很多的开源库都是部署在g

ESP32学习记录------点灯科技blinker(VS Code PlatformIO )

ERROR: Maybe you have put in the wrong AuthKey! [66421] ERROR: Or maybe your request is too frequently! [66424] ERROR: Or maybe your network is disconnected! 解决办法使用github上最新的blinker库 见学习过程二、3 # ESP3

基于VSCode + PlatformIO创建运行第一个esp32程序

文章目录 使用VSCode创建项目安装驱动下载驱动安装驱动连接开发板电脑识别开发板 编写程序烧录程序第一步、编译程序第二步、烧录程序第三步、开发板观察效果 原理讲解项目源码 在之前的课程,我们已经介绍了ESP32单片机,并且也已经安装好了开发环境,从这节课开始,我们将正式步入ESP32的实战开发中来。 说到单片机开发,开篇一定离不开点亮LED灯,我们也不例外,接下来,我们一起写

VSCode + PlatformIO ESP32开发环境配置(离线版5分钟搞定)

文章目录 安装python1. 打开应用商店2. 应用商店搜索`python`3. 安装python4. python安装完成5. 打开命令提示符6. 验证安装结果7. 更新pip源为国内源 安装VSCode下载VSCode安装Vscode安装简体中文插件安装VSCode platformio插件安装Prettier - Code formatter插件 (建议安装)安装Error Lens

如何在VSCode上的PlatformIO IDE使用Arduino库文件

1. 找到项目文件夹下的“lib”文件夹,并点击进入 这里博主事先已经把相对应的库文件挪进了“lib”文件目录下 2.在Visual Studio Code下的PlatformIO IDE里打开项目文件夹,找到“.vscode”文件下的“c_cpp_properties.json”文件 3.进入“c_cpp_properties.json”文件找到“includePath”关键字,在其下添加你

platformIO开发arduino

第一先安装arduino,再在arduino库里面安装第三方库。然后下载vscode,在vscode上安装platformIO,然后点击Quick Access下的Import Arduino Project 然后选择自己的arudino项目,一般在用户的Document下面 进入带有.ino后缀的文件夹里然后点击import就可以将项目进行导入。 然后就可以点击下面状态栏的编译下载

解决PlatformIO下载速度慢以及容易出错(解决vscode下载缓慢问题)

Content 问题描述:依赖下载缓慢问题解决:为vscode配置代理端口 问题描述:依赖下载缓慢 Arduino对于ESP32的开发提供了众多的库,但是Arduino IDE编译速度过于缓慢的问题属实让人难受。 为此我们使用vscode中的platformIO插件,但是PlatformIO虽然安装快,但是安装依赖有时候一晚上都下载不完,甚至还会报错异常停止。 本文为VSco